7420 Biscayne Blvd, Miami, FL 33138We We's Coffee Shop in Miami has accumulated 141 violations across 24 inspections, averaging 5.9 violations per inspection—modestly above Florida's statewide average of 5.2. High-priority violations have been recurrent, with food contact surface deficiencies cited in at least 8 of the most recent 8 inspections, chemical storage violations appearing in 4 of the past 6 inspections, and employee health reporting violations documented multiple times. The facility has not been emergency-closed. The most recent two inspections on March 30 and 31, 2026 identified serious violations including improper hand/arm washing, shell stock requirements failures, and management awareness deficiencies; the March 31 inspection resulted in a call back with extension pending, indicating non-compliance requiring follow-up verification.
